Embodiment Construction

[0022] The present invention will be further described below in conjunction with the accompanying drawings.

[0023] Such as figure 1 , 2 As shown, the present invention includes a driving mechanism 1, a cross bar 2, a linear rod 3, a support arm 6, a door panel 9, a sealing support 10, and the like. Drive mechanism 1 utilizes bearing 14 to be fixed on the outer reinforcing beam on the air duct, and its telescopic shaft is fixedly connected to cross bar 2 with pins. The cross bar 2 is connected with one end of two straight rods 3 with a nut, and guide wheels 4 are arranged on the other end of each straight rod. The linear tie rod 3 is also provided with a sealing support 10. The main function of the sealing support 10 is to seal the pressurized and high-temperature gas in the system, and the second is to guide and support the movement of the linear tie rod 3. Abstract

The invention discloses a turning-plate-type elastic hot wind isolating door which is used for solving the problems such as non-tight close, over-long close operation time, and the like, of the traditional isolating door. The isolating door is characterized in that a connecting transverse rod is fixed by a telescopic shaft of a driving mechanism; the transverse rod is connected with two straight pulling rods; the other end of each straight pulling rod is connected with two regulating plates; slide guide wheels arranged at the connection parts; two articulated chains are utilized for a door plate and two supporting arms; the door plate is provided with two door pulling rods; and each door pulling rod and each supporting arm are all connected with the two regulating plates. The isolating door provided by the invention has the advantages of flexible opening and closure and tight sealing, ensures that the switching and checking of devices can be carried out conveniently, has short installation period, and can be installed within a minor repair period of 3-5 days, is simple and convenient to operate, has long service life, can be installed once without maintenance, and can be installed on air ducts of a random angle position and different cross section shapes.

Description

Technical field: [0001] The invention relates to a windshield door, in particular to an isolation door for opening and closing hot air at the entrance of a coal mill. Background technique: [0002] The hot air isolation door is a shut-off door installed on the hot air outlet of the boiler air preheater of the thermal power plant to the coal mill inlet pipe. It is mainly used for the isolation and maintenance of the coal mill to isolate the hot air and avoid the hot air at about 340 ° C from hurting maintenance personnel. [0003] Most of the current isolation doors are of the plug-in type, and there are phenomena such as poor isolation closure, long closing time, a large amount of air leakage, easy dust accumulation, high temperature switch failure, etc., resulting in hot air leakage and difficult system maintenance.
